The DCA quotation of phosphate rights this week amounts to €137,50 per right. This means that the price remains the same as the level of the past 2 weeks. According to a number of commission agents, price stability is mainly due to the wait-and-see attitude of both buyers and sellers.
The supply and demand ratio is in balance and there is little enthusiasm on both sides. Buyers wait until prices drop a bit, while sellers do not actually want to lose any rights for the current prices. The current price level is approximately 14% lower than the price in the same period last year.
Regional question
Since the system was introduced, many phosphate rights have gone to the north of the country. The trend on the market is that demand around the country is now more proportionate and that in recent years there has also been an increasing demand for phosphate rights from the south.
